This spring site, maintained by the National Park Service Water Resources Division (identifier 11NPSWRD_WQX), has the name "Tanapag I Spring" and has the identifier 11NPSWRD_WQX-AMME_GS6_TS1. This site is in the watershed defined by the 8 digit Hydrologic Unit Code (HUC)22020000.
This site is located in Saipan Municipality County, Northern Mariana Islands at 15.2319444400 degrees latitude and 145.7550000000 degrees longitude using the datum NAD83. No horizontal location accuracy metadata is available.

| MonitoringLocationDescriptionText | This station is at Tanapag Spring No. 1. The spring is approximately 0.6 miles upstream from mouth, and 0.7 miles south of Tanapag School. The aquifer is described as Andesite or volcanic lava. Well 8a was drilled in the spring in September 1944. The discharge was reported as artesian water flowing from the well by Mink (1977). Tanapag Spring No. 1 is also known as Bobo Agatan. |
